1. Understanding Eco-Friendly Materials
Eco-friendly materials refer to substances that have a minimal negative impact on the environment. In the context of road bike path construction, these materials can significantly reduce the carbon footprint associated with traditional construction methods. Common eco-friendly materials include recycled asphalt, permeable concrete, and sustainably sourced timber. Recycled asphalt, for instance, not only reduces waste but also minimizes the need for new raw materials. 2. The Benefits of Using Recycled Materials
One of the most significant advantages of incorporating recycled materials in bike path construction is the reduction of landfill waste. Recycled materials such as tire rubber can be repurposed to create durable surfaces that enhance the biking experience while being eco-friendly. Additionally, using recycled materials often results in lower costs and less energy consumption during the manufacturing process. In New Zealand, local councils have been exploring the use of recycled materials in various infrastructure projects, including bike paths. For example, the Wellington City Council has implemented the use of recycled asphalt in some bike lanes, showcasing a commitment to bike sustainability and innovative recycling practices. 3. Permeable Pavements: A Sustainable Choice
Permeable pavements are an eco-friendly option for bike path construction that allows rainwater to pass through the surface, reducing runoff and promoting groundwater recharge. This material is particularly beneficial in areas prone to flooding or where stormwater management is a concern. In New Zealand, where heavy rainfall can lead to significant surface water issues, permeable pavements can mitigate these challenges while providing a durable surface for cyclists. 4. The Role of Sustainable Timber in Bike Path Design
Sustainable timber is another eco-friendly material that can be utilized in bike path construction, particularly for wooden structures such as bridges or seating areas along the path. Timber sourced from certified sustainable forests ensures that the materials used do not contribute to deforestation, preserving natural habitats. In New Zealand, native timber varieties, such as sustainably harvested radiata pine, can be used effectively in bike path designs. 5. Innovative Biomaterials in Path Construction
Biomaterials, derived from natural resources, are emerging as a cutting-edge solution in road bike path construction. Materials such as bio-asphalt, which is produced from organic materials like vegetable oils, offer a sustainable alternative to conventional asphalt. These innovative materials are designed to reduce greenhouse gas emissions and improve the overall sustainability of bike paths.
